Definition: Notwithstanding

Notwithstanding

Adverb

1. Despite anything to the contrary (usually following a concession); "although I'm a little afraid, however I'd like to try it"; "while we disliked each other, nevertheless we agreed"; "he was a stern yet fair master"; "granted that it is dangerous, all the same I still want to go".

Source: WordNet 1.7.1 Copyright © 2001 by Princeton University. All rights reserved.
 

Date "notwithstanding" was first used in popular English literature: sometime before 1321. (references)

 

Synonyms: Notwithstanding

Synonyms: all the same (adv), even so (adv), however (adv), nevertheless (adv), nonetheless (adv), still (adv), withal (adv), yet (adv). (additional references)

Historic Usage: Notwithstanding

AuthorDateQuotation

John Locke

1690

But, notwithstanding such resistance, the king's person and authority are still both secured, and so no danger to governor or government. (Second Treatise of Government)

US Constitution

1791

Clause 2: This Constitution, and the Laws of the United States which shall be made in Pursuance thereof; and all Treaties made, or which shall be made, under the Authority of the United States, shall be the supreme Law of the Land; and the Judges in every State shall be bound thereby, any Thing in the Constitution or Laws of any State to the Contrary notwithstanding. (reference)

Marbury v. Madison

1803

It would declare that if the legislature shall do what is expressly forbidden, such act, notwithstanding the express prohibition, is in reality effectual. (reference)

Treaty of Versailles

1919

This provision will apply notwithstanding any proceedings or prosecution before a tribunal in Germany or in the territory of her allies. (reference)

Usage Frequency: Notwithstanding

"Notwithstanding" is generally used as a preposition (except "of") -- approximately 77.21% of the time. "Notwithstanding" is used about 701 times out of a sample of 100 million words spoken or written in English. Its rank is based on over 700,000 words used in the English language. Some parts-of-speech are not covered due to the samples used by the British National Corpus. (note: percents less than one-hundredth of one percent have been omitted)
Parts of SpeechPercentUsage per
100 Million Words
Rank in English
Preposition (except "of")77.21%54111,416
Adverb (general)21.23%14925,810
Conjunction (subordinating)1.57%11106,044
                    Total100.00%701N/A

Bible Trace: Notwithstanding

LanguageDateSourceActs Chapter 15, Verse 34
Greek (transliterated)250 BCSeptuagintEdoxen de tw sila epimeinai autou
Latin405Vulgate[]
Middle English1395WyclifBut it was seyn to Silas, to dwelle there; and Judas wente aloone to Jerusalem.
Renaissance English1526TyndaleNot with stondynge it pleasyd Sylas to abyde there still.
Jacobean English1611King JamesNotwithstanding it pleased Silas to abide there still.
Victorian English1833WebsterNotwithstanding, it pleased Silas to abide there still.
